Abstract
BackgroundVacuoles, E1 enzyme, X-linked, autoinflammatory, somatic (VEXAS) syndrome is a recently identified disorder caused by somatic mutations in the UBA1 gene of myeloid cells. Various manifestations of pulmonary involvement have been reported, but a detailed description of lung involvement and radiologic findings is lacking.ObjectivesTo describe lung involvement in VEXAS syndrome.MethodsA retrospective cohort study was conducted of all patients identified at the Mayo Clinic with VEXAS syndrome since October 2020. Clinical records and chest high resolution computed tomography (HRCT) scans were reviewed.ResultsOur cohort comprised 22 white men with a median age of 69 years (IQR 62-74, range 57-84). Hematologic disorders including multiple myeloma, myelodysplastic syndrome and pancytopenia were present in 10 patients (45%), rheumatologic diseases including granulomatosis with polyangiitis, IgG4-related disease, polyarteritis nodosa, relapsing polychondritis, and rheumatoid arthritis were found in 10 patients (45%), and 4 patients had dermatologic presentations including Sweet syndrome, Schnitzer-like syndrome or drug rash with eosinophilia skin syndrome (DRESS). VEXAS syndrome-related features included fever (18, 82%), skin lesions (20, 91%), lung infiltrates (12, 55%), chondritis (10, 45%), venous thromboembolism (12, 55%), macrocytic anemia (21, 96%), and bone marrow vacuoles (21, 96%). Other manifestations observed were arthritis, scleritis, hoarseness and hearing loss. Median erythrocyte sedimentation rate (ESR) was 69 mm/1st hour (IQR 34.3-118.8) and median C-reactive protein (CRP) of 55.5 mg/dL (IQR 11.4-98.8). The somatic mutations affecting methionine-41 (p.Met41) in UBA1 gene were: 11 (50%) p.Met41Thr, 7 (32%) p.Met41Val, 2 (9%) p.Met41Leu, and 2 (9%) in the splice site. All patients received glucocorticoids (GC) (median duration of treatment was 2.6 years); 21 (96%) received conventional immunosuppressive agents (methotrexate, azathioprine, mycophenolate, leflunomide, cyclosporin, hydroxychloroquine, tofacitinib, ruxolitinib) and 9 (41%) received biologic agents (rituximab, tocilizumab, infliximab, etanercept, adalimumab, golimumab, abatacept). Respiratory symptoms included dyspnea and cough present in 21 (95%) and 12 (55%), respectively, and were documented prior to VEXAS diagnosis. Most of the patients were non-smokers (14, 64%) and obstructive sleep apnea (OSA) was present in 11 patients (50%). Seven patients (32%) used non-invasive ventilation, 6 used C-PAP, and 1 used Bi-PAP. Bronchoalveolar lavage (BAL) was available in 4 patients, and the findings were compatible with neutrophilic alveolitis in 3. Two patients had lung biopsies (2 transbronchial and 1 surgical) that showed ATTR amyloidosis and organizing pneumonia with lymphoid interstitial pneumonia, respectively. Pulmonary function tests were available in 9 (41%) patients and showed normal results in 5; 3 patients had isolated reduction in DLCO and 1 with mild restriction. On chest HRCT, 16 patients (73%) had parenchymal changes including ground-glass opacities in 9, septal thickening in 4, and nodules in 3; pleural effusions were present in 3 patients, air-trapping in 3 patients and tracheomalacia in 1 patient. Follow-up chest HRCT was available for 8 patients (36%), the ground-glass opacities resolved in 5 patients, 3 patients manifested new or increased ground-glass opacities, and 1 patient had increased interlobular septal thickening. After 1 year of follow-up, 4 patients (17%) had died; 3 due to pneumonia (2 COVID-19,1 bacterial) and 1 due to heart failure. VEXAS flares occurred in 18 patients (82%), the maximum number of relapses was 7, and they were mainly managed with GC and with changes in the immunosuppressive regimen.ConclusionPulmonary involvement was documented by chest HRCT in most patients with VEXAS syndrome. Respiratory symptoms occurred in over one half of patients and about 20% had PFT abnormalities. The pulmonary manifestations of VEXAS are nonspecific and characterized predominantly by inflammatory parenchymal involvement.Disclosure of InterestsNone declared

Abstract
BACKGROUND Variation in the posterior cord of the brachial plexus is complicated and creates a risky relationship with the neighbouring structures. This is of importance to the surgeons, anaesthetists who must deal with the region in surgeries and procedures. Moreover, any benign tumour like Schwannoma is rare in the plexus comprising 5 % of total head and neck schwannomas. METHODS We present a case of Schwannoma of the brachial plexus in a cadaver during routine anatomy dissection for the medical students. The origin and order of branching of the posterior cord were recorded and photographs were taken. The tumour was present in an accessory branch of the posterior cord and removal was made in-toto. An immunohistochemistry study was done for confirmation of diagnosis. RESULTS The classical branching of the posterior cord was present. Additionally, a branch existed that was supplying the triceps muscle and emerged directly from the posterior cord. Tumour having the dimension of 2 x 1.8x 0.5 cm was present. CONCLUSIONS Schwannomas are indolent but may cause compression of the nerve and resulting neurological symptoms. They might mimic nodules of supraclavicular fossa in breast carcinoma. Variations of the brachial plexus can also make the surgeons confused during surgery due to which anatomical knowledge of the possible variations is important. Pre- and Post-operative complications can be easily predicted from it. Follow-up of the tumour is essential to track its progress and differentiation.

Abstract
Although KITD816V occurs universally in adult systemic mastocytosis (SM), the clinical heterogeneity of SM suggests presence of additional phenotype-patterning mutations. Because up to 25% of SM patients have KITD816V-positive eosinophilia, we undertook whole-exome sequencing in a patient with aggressive SM with eosinophilia to identify novel genetic alterations. We conducted sequencing of purified eosinophils (clone/tumor sample), with T-lymphocytes as the matched control/non-tumor sample. In addition to KITD816V, we identified a somatic missense mutation in ethanolamine kinase 1 (ETNK1N244S) that was not present in 50 healthy controls. Targeted resequencing of 290 patients showed ETNK1 mutations to be distributed as follows: (i) SM (n=82; 6% mutated); (ii) chronic myelomonocytic leukemia (CMML; n=29; 14% mutated); (iii) idiopathic hypereosinophilia (n=137; <1% mutated); (iv) primary myelofibrosis (n=32; 0% mutated); and (v) others (n=10; 0% mutated). Of the 82 SM cases, 25 had significant eosinophilia; of these 20% carried ETNK1 mutations. The ten mutations (N244S=6, N244T=1, N244K=1, G245A=2) targeted two contiguous amino acids in the ETNK1 kinase domain, and are predicted to be functionally disruptive. In summary, we identified novel somatic missense ETNK1 mutations that were most frequent in SM with eosinophilia and CMML; this suggests a potential pathogenetic role for dysregulated cytidine diphosphate-ethanolamine pathway metabolites in these diseases.

Abstract
BACKGROUND Atherosclerosis is a complex histopathologic process that is analogous to chronic inflammatory conditions. Several factors have been shown to correlate with the extent of atherosclerosis. Whereas hypertension, obesity, hyperlipidemia, diabetes, smoking, and family history are all well documented, recent literature points to additional associated factors. Thus, antibodies to oxidized low-density lipoprotein (oxLDL), cytomegalovirus (CMV), Chlamydia pneumonia, Helicobacter pylori, as well as homocysteine and C-reactive protein (CRP) levels have all been implicated as independent markers of accelerated atherosclerosis. HYPOTHESIS In the current study we attempted to formulate a system by which to predict the extent of coronary atherosclerosis as assessed by angiographic vessel occlusion. METHODS The 81 patients were categorized as having single-, double-, triple-, or no vessel involvement. The clinical data concerning the "classic" risk factors were obtained from clinical records, and sera were drawn from the patients for determination of the various parameters that are thought to be associated with atherosclerosis. RESULTS Using four artificial neural networks, we have found the most effective parameters predictive of coronary vessel involvement were (in decreasing order of importance) antibodies to oxLDL, to cardiolipin, to CMV, to Chlamydia pneumonia, and to beta 2-glycoprotein I (beta 2GPI). Although important in the prediction of vessel occlusion, hyperlipidemia, hypertension, CRP levels, and diabetes were less accurate. CONCLUSION The results of the current study, if reproduced in a larger population, may establish an integrated system based on the creation of artificial neural networks by which to predict the extent of atherosclerosis in a given subject fairly and noninvasively.

Abstract
Recombinant activated factor VII (rFVIIa, NovoSeven) enhances haemostasis in individuals, with its predominant action limited to areas of injury, apparently without systemic activation of the coagulation cascade. rFVIIa is currently licensed in most countries worldwide, for its use in the treatment of bleeding episodes in patients with hemophilia and the presence of inhibitors. Recently in the European Union, rFVIIa, has been approved for use in congenital Factor VII deficiency and Glanzmann's thrombasthenia. Furthermore, a large number of case series studies and anecdotal evidences, from patients with different bleeding conditions, have now shown that rFVIIa is actually a very valuable general haemostatic agent. It has been reported to reduce bleeding in patients with liver disease, thrombocytopenia/thrombocytopathia, trauma, spontaneous intracerebral hemorrhage and in the reversal of anticoagulant overdosage or toxicity. A number of trials have been carried out, which have shown that it is a relatively safe and well tolerated drug with a few episodes of unwanted thrombosis.

Abstract
The Gen-Probe APTIMA Combo 2 (AC2) is a Food and Drug Administration-cleared nucleic acid amplification test (NAAT) for the detection of Chlamydia trachomatis and Neisseria gonorrhoeae from urine and urogenital swab specimens. The Centers for Disease Control and Prevention have recommended confirmation of positive NAAT results in low-prevalence populations. APTIMA CT (ACT) and APTIMA GC (AGC) are two discrete NAATs for C. trachomatis and N. gonorrhoeae detection that are suitable for confirming AC2-positive results because they target different nucleic acid sequences. Our objective was to determine if ACT and AGC could be used as confirmatory tests for AC2 and to correlate the APTIMA assays with culture, direct fluorescent-antibody (DFA), and LCx CT and GC assays. Urine and swab specimens (1,304) were initially tested with either culture, DFA, or LCx, followed by AC2. A subset (675) was then tested with ACT and AGC. There was absolute concordance between ACT-AGC and AC2. LCx did not detect 1 of 14 AC2-ACT- and 1 of 6 AC2-AGC-positive urine samples, and it yielded one C. trachomatis- and one N. gonorrhoeae-positive swab result that were not detected by AC2 and ACT-AGC. Culture failed to detect 5 of 20 AC2-ACT and 3 of 4 AC2-AGC positives, and DFA missed 4 of 4 AC2-ACT positives. Thus, ACT and AGC relative sensitivity compared to that of AC2 was 100%. All APTIMA assays detected more confirmed positive results than culture, DFA, and LCx. The performance of APTIMA assays was not altered by the use of various swab types and by long-term storage of specimens. All APTIMA assays are highly sensitive and rapid. ACT and AGC can be recommended for confirmation of positive results from other NAATs, such as AC2 and LCx.

Abstract
OBJECTIVE To evaluate traditional and non-traditional risk factors for subclinical atherosclerosis in systemic lupus erythematosus (SLE). METHODS A prospective cohort of 78 patients with SLE without overt atherosclerotic disease was studied. SLE clinical and laboratory parameters, disease activity and damage, treatment and traditional risk factors for atherosclerosis were evaluated. At baseline (T1) and after five years' follow up (T2), the serum levels of anti-oxidised palmitoyl arachidonoyl phosphocholine (oxPAPC), anti-heat shock protein 65, and anti-beta(2)-glycoprotein I antibodies and C reactive protein were tested. At T2, intima-media thickness (IMT) was measured using duplex carotid sonography. Thickened intima, plaque, mean IMT (m-IMT), and maximum IMT (M-IMT) were assessed. RESULTS A thickened intima was seen in 22/78 (28%) patients and plaque in 13/78 (17%). M-IMT and m-IMT were (mean (SD)) 0.77 (0.34) mm and 0.55 (0.15) mm, respectively. Patients with carotid abnormalities were significantly older, had higher blood pressure and total serum cholesterol levels, and had taken a higher prednisone cumulative dosage than those without any lesions. The carotid abnormalities were associated with renal disease and ECLAM >2 at T1, and with azathioprine treatment. In multivariate analysis, age and cumulative prednisone dose were associated with carotid abnormalities; age, hypertension, and anti-oxPAPC at T2 were correlated with higher M-IMT and m-IMT. CONCLUSIONS In patients with SLE some non-traditional risk factors for atherosclerosis were identified, the most important of which was the cumulative prednisone dose. The role of some traditional risk factors, such as age and hypertension, was also confirmed. The predictive value of the new immunological and inflammatory markers of atherosclerosis seems to be masked by some disease related features.

Abstract
Conventional methods for identification of Mycobacterium tuberculosis from culture can take 6 weeks. To facilitate the rapid detection of M. tuberculosis and to assess the risks of drug resistance, we developed a technique of eluting DNA directly from sputum slides and performing PCR for the detection of M. tuberculosis DNA, followed by sequencing the rpoB gene to detect rifampin resistance. This entire process requires only 48 h. Forty-seven sputum specimens submitted for microscopy for detection of acid-fast bacilli (AFB) and for mycobacterial culture and susceptibility testing were assessed after elution from the slides and extraction. M. tuberculosis-specific DNA was amplified in a nested PCR with previously described primers (primers rpo95-rpo293 and rpo105-rpo273), followed by analysis on a 4% agarose gel for a 168-bp product. Automated sequencing was performed, and the sequences were aligned against a database for detection of anomalies in the rpoB gene (codons 511 to 533) which indicate rifampin resistance. Of the 47 sputum specimens tested, 51% (24 of 47) were culture positive (time to positive culture, 2 to 6 weeks). Smears for AFB were positive for 58% (14 of 24) of the specimens and were negative for 42% (10 of 24) of the specimens. All 24 culture-positive sputum specimens (14 microscopy-positive and 10 microscopy-negative sputum specimens) were positive by PCR with eluates from the smears. Forty-nine percent (23 of 47) of the sputum specimens were negative for M. tuberculosis by smear, culture, and PCR. Of the isolates from the culture-positive samples, five were rifampin resistant by sequencing; all five were also rifampin resistant by in vitro susceptibility testing. Of these rifampin-resistant M. tuberculosis isolates, two were microscopy negative for AFB. Patients who are negative for AFB and culture positive for M. tuberculosis can now be identified within a day, allowing institution of therapy and reducing isolation time and medical costs.

Abstract
HIV+ patients fail antiretroviral therapy due to inadequate drug concentrations reaching the site of viral replication and/or the development of viral resistance to the antiretroviral agents. Adequate drug concentrations may not be reaching the virus due to poor compliance, poor absorption, or other pharmacokinetic factors such as metabolism, elimination, and drug interactions. The most important and most common pharmacokinetic drug interactions involve inhibition of metabolism, induction of metabolism, altered drug absorption, inhibition of renal excretion, and displacement from plasma protein binding sites. If a patient is failing antiretroviral therapy, TDM of antiretroviral agents could help in determining both adequacy of drug concentrations and patients' adherence. Ongoing studies will determine whether total drug concentration or free drug concentration of the protease inhibitors is the best predictor of response. Trough concentrations could prove to be the most important predictor of response, but additional studies are needed to compare trough, peak, and AUC concentrations with response to treatment. Finally, if some patients fail therapy due to inadequate drug concentrations, then increasing the dose could benefit patients' outcome and increase longevity. Clinical trials are needed that compare patients who receive a fixed-dosage regimen with patients who have adjusted dose regimens. Such a study is the best way to determine the true value of TDM of the antiretrovirals.

Abstract
Seroprevalence of HHV-8 has been studied in Malaysia, India, Sri Lanka, Thailand, Trinidad, Jamaica and the USA, in both healthy individuals and those infected with HIV. Seroprevalence was found to be low in these countries in both the healthy and the HIV-infected populations. This correlates with the fact that hardly any AIDS-related Kaposi's sarcoma has been reported in these countries. In contrast, the African countries of Ghana, Uganda and Zambia showed high seroprevalences in both healthy and HIV-infected populations. This suggests that human herpes virus-8 (HHV-8) may be either a recently introduced virus or one that has extremely low infectivity. Nasopharyngeal and oral carcinoma patients from Malaysia, Hong Kong and Sri Lanka who have very high EBV titres show that only 3/82 (3.7%) have antibody to HHV-8, demonstrating that there is little, if any, cross-reactivity between antibodies to these two gamma viruses.

Abstract
In a blinded fashion, 165 serum samples from patients with biopsy-characterized acute and chronic renal diseases (ACRDs), 34 serum samples from patients with congenital renal diseases (CRDs), and 100 serum samples from healthy adults were assayed for immunoglobulin G (IgG), IgM, and IgA antibodies to Hantaan and Puumala viruses by enzyme immunoassay (EIA). Twenty-six percent (44 of 165) of ACRDs, 3% (1 of 34) of CRDs, and none (0 of 100) of the healthy serum samples were positive for hantavirus-specific antibodies (P < 0.001, Fisher's exact test). Thirty of 44 positive serum samples (68%) were from three groups: ie, acute tubulointerstitial nephritis (AIN), 20% (9 of 44); necrotizing glomerulonephritis (NG), 27% (12 of 44); and IgA nephropathy, 20% (9 of 44). The remaining 14 positive samples were from patients with a varied group of renal conditions. IgA antibody levels alone were elevated in 37%, IgG alone in 33%, IgM alone in 17%, and all three isotypes in 13% of the AIN-, NG-, and IgA-positive samples. These data indicate that three renal diseases account for approximately 68% of the hantavirus-positive sera tested and that serological evaluations should include all three isotypes of antibodies.

Abstract
The hantavirus is known to cause hemorraghic fever with renal syndrome (HFRS), which is widely spread in Europe and Asia. Several reports have shown an association of hantavirus antibody titers and the occurrence of renal dysfunction. From these observations, it appears that the virus is widely distributed, and different strains prevail in various areas. In the present work we studied 81 patients with end-stage renal-failure under hemodialysis (HD) treatment, 55 with mild to moderate renal failure, and 50 healthy subjects for the presence of antibodies to Hantaan and Puumala viruses. We found that 12.3% of the hemodialysis patients and 9% of the mild to moderate renal failure patients had elevated IgG anti-body titers to Puumala virus compared with 2% of the controls. IgM antibodies to Puumala virus was principally elevated in patient with chronic renal failure (CRF) not on hemodialysis (14.5%) compared with the hemodialyzed (1.2%) and controls (0%) subjects. Hantaan virus IgG antibodies were detected in 3.7% of the HD patients, 5.5% of the CRF not on HD, and in none of the controls. IgM Hantaan antibodies were found only in the non-HD renal failure patients. None of the sera were found to contain antibodies to phospholipids or single-stranded DNA. These results emphasize the widespread nature of infection with hantaviruses and imply that elaborate testing for these serologies should be performed, especially in patients with unexplained renal failure.

Abstract
Viruses have long been suggested to be involved in the etiology of multiple sclerosis (MS). This suggestion is based on (1) epidemiological evidence of childhood exposure to infectious agents and increase in disease exacerbations with viral infection; (2) geographic association of disease susceptibility with evidence of MS clustering; (3) evidence that migration to and from high-risk areas influences the likelihood of developing MS; (4) abnormal immune responses to a variety of viruses; and (5) analogy with animal models and other human diseases in which viruses can cause diseases with long incubation periods, a relapsing-remitting course, and demyelination. Many of these studies involve the demonstration of increased antibody titers to a particular virus, whereas some describe isolation of virus from MS material. However, no virus to date has been definitively associated with this disease. Recently, human herpesvirus 6 (HHV-6), a newly described beta-herpes virus that shares homology with cytomegalovirus (CMV), has been reported to be present in active MS plaques. In order to extend these observations, we have demonstrated increased IgM serum antibody responses to HHV-6 early antigen (p41/38) in patients with relapsing-remitting MS (RRMS), compared with patients with chronic progressive MS (CPMS), patients with other neurologic disease (OND), patients with other autoimmune disease (OID), and normal controls. Given the ubiquitous nature of this virus and the challenging precedent of correlating antiviral antibodies with disease association, these antibody studies have been supported by the detection of HHV-6 DNA from samples of MS serum as a marker of active viral infection.

Abstract
To evaluate the association between human herpesvirus 6 (HHV-6) and chronic fatigue syndrome (CFS), 2 geographically separate groups of CFS patients (125 and 29 patients, respectively) and healthy controls (150 and 15 controls, respectively) were compared, using an EIA, for antibodies to HHV-6 early antigen p41/38 (EA). Sixty percent (93/154) of CFS patients were were positive for HHV-6 EA IgM, 40% (61/154) were positive for IgG, and 23% (35/154) were positive for both. A total of 119 (77%) of the CFS patients were positive for HHV-6 EA IgG or IgM (or both); only 12% (20/165) of the controls had IgG or IgM to HHV-6 EA. These data demonstrate that more CFS patients than controls had elevated levels of HHV-6 EA-specific IgM, perhaps indicating active replication of HHV-6 in CFS.

Abstract
To determine the association between recent human immunodeficiency virus (HIV)-associated dementia and serum antibodies to Bartonella (Rochalimaea) henselae, we performed a nested case control study within the Multicenter AIDS Cohort Study in Los Angeles. We measured serum IgG and IgM antibodies to B. henselae with use of enzyme immunoassay in 369 HIV-seropositive and HIV-seronegative participants with and without recent neuropsychological deterioration. Data on pet ownership were also collected. IgM antibodies to B. henselae were strongly associated with neuropsychological decline or dementia (OR = 6.6;95% CI = 1.4-31.9;P = .02). Those participants with IgM antibodies to B. henselae were 1.7 times more likely to develop HIV-associated dementia (HAD) or neuropsychological decline over the next 5 years. At least 4% of the new cases of HAD and neuropsychological decline were due to bartonella infection. Cat ownership was associated with the presence of IgM antibodies to B. henselae (OR = 6.4;95% CI = 1.3-30.8;p = .02) and with neuropsychological decline and dementia (OR = 2.4;95% CI = 1.2-5.1;P = .02). This finding suggests that some cases of HAD and neuropsychological decline are associated with potentially treatable B. henselae infections.

Abstract
Rochalimaea henselae, a recently described pathogen thought to cause syndromes as varied as bacillary angiomatosis, parenchymal bacillary peliosis, fever with bacteremia, and cat-scratch disease, is associated with CNS diseases including cerebral and retinal bacillary angiomatosis, as well as cat-scratch-related encephalitis, myelitis, cerebral arteritis, and retinitis. We used a newly developed enzyme immunoassay and the polymerase chain reaction to investigate the association of R henselae infection with HIV-related CNS disease and found that whereas seroprevalence rates in HIV-positive patients unselected for neurologic disease were 4% to 5.5%, those with neurologic disease had seroprevalence rates of 32%. The ratio of organism-specific antibodies in CSF compared with serum suggested intra-blood-brain-barrier synthesis of these antibodies. CSF specimens containing only R henselae IgM had 16S rDNA specific for R henselae. Stored serum from one of these patients indicated he had developed R henselae-reactive IgM antibodies 10 months prior to the onset of neurologic disease. In the 14 patients for whom clinical data were available, evidence of CNS invasion by R henselae was accompanied by acute and subacute mental status changes including hallucinations, disorientation, and rapidly progressive dementia.

Abstract
Cat scratch disease, which is caused by infection with Rochalimaea henselae, is often manifested as lymphadenopathy. R. henselae has also been isolated from human immunodeficiency virus (HIV)-positive patients with bacillary angiomatosis. In order to determine the frequency of R. henselae-reactive antibodies in HIV-positive patients with persistent generalized lymphadenopathy (PGL) or non-Hodgkin's lymphoma (NHL), we tested a total of 124 HIV-positive patients for R. henselae-reactive immunoglobulin G (IgG), IgM, and IgA antibodies by an enzyme immunoassay procedure using whole R. henselae antigen. Of the patients, 7 had PGL, 17 had NHL, and 100 were HIV stage IV (Centers for Disease Control criteria). A total of 86% of PGL patients (6 of 7) were positive for R. henselae antibodies (three were positive for IgG, IgA, and IgM, one was positive for IgG and IgA only, and two were positive for IgG only). A total of 29% of NHL patients (5 of 17) were positive for R. henselae antibodies (two were positive for IgG, IgA, and IgM and three were positive for IgG only). Only 5% of HIV Stage IV patients without adenopathy (5 of 100) were positive for R. henselae-reactive IgG, IgA, and IgM. The high prevalence of R. henselae-reactive antibodies in HIV-positive PGL and NHL patients suggests that R. henselae is a potential etiologic agent or cofactor in these patients.
